Abstract

A system is disclosed for incorporating a realistic simulated catheter or catheters within a catheter guidance and control system that operate from the same closed-loop position control feedback and geometric mapping data as the real position control system and are able to make contact with real and simulated datasets. These catheters may be operated in a pure simulation mode without interacting with real catheters and position control hardware, or may be used as control cursors to enhance the placement of catheter positioning targets. The catheter tip, which is focus of magnetic control, is realistically guided by the control system parameters, while the remainder of the catheter line is realistically constrained by the mapped chamber geometry and introducer sheath.

Claims (4)

1 . A method for use of a catheter control kinematic algorithm as a predictive motion control cursor.

2 . A method for use of a catheter control kinematic algorithm as a regulator development and testing fixture.

3 . A method for use of a catheter control kinematic algorithm as a simulation training tool.

4 . A method for using a Runge-Kutta Ordinary Differential Equation based physics engine to simulate the geometry and dynamics of a catheter within a three dimensional manifold.
